The HRA-NCA Career Management Program (CMP) is one of the most rewarding and beneficial activities offered by HRA-NCA. Meetings combine presentations on various facets of career building, such as how and why to pursue certification, with plenty of time for networking and resume exchange. For HR professionals beginning their careers, the CMP provides an invaluable resource of experience and expertise to help you climb the career ladder. For experienced HR professionals, it offers the opportunity to give back to your profession and help others learn from your success. CMP meetings are intended for HRA-NCA members as a benefit of membership. Non-members may attend once before joining the chapter.
